2017《面向对象程序设计》课程作业三
对于文件读写和多参数主函数学习过程中遇到的问题
这次文件读写改用了C++的形式,然后总体还算顺利,借鉴了林燊的,因为他写的代码最容易看懂;还有就是借鉴了《C++程序设计》,讲真,谭浩强的还是比较好理解的,初学的话用他的书更好,一下子用《C++Primer Plus》还是有些乱的。
好了,现在我都分离完了。总的分成4个类,分别实现文件操作、随机数生成、算式生成加计算、语言文件调用。main函数里还有Menu、scan、print函数,那几个我觉得太短没有分离的必要,就仍然放在main.cpp里面,这是分类后的布局
目前程序效果图是这样的
GitHub上传记录
因为这次我终于下定决心重写代码了,所以很多事情完成的比较慢。本来是要和别人合作先把寒假第一次要求的写出来,结果对方时间赶不及,想不出怎么写,我就只好自己完成了。到目前算是完成了,不过我还想改进一下,比如增加分数运算。